I would not touch the diff bearings. Your R&P adjustment shims are inbetween the bearing and the differential. Leave them be unless they fall apart when you remove it. They are pressed onto the diff. Make sure NOT to re-install the diff bearing retainers backwards, put them back in EXACTLY they way they were, # 19 in your pic.
A trick to removing that seal inside the diff housing is to use a broom handel from the wheel side and pound it out by simply using the broom handel like a slide hammer, works great and the wood does not mar or damage the diff.
D44 is perrty simple to rebuild once you get familiar with all the parts.
